While playing with headlights I noticed the voltmeter was only showing 12v with the engine running. Had the alternator checked it had failed. It was the original one that was on the motor. So down to my favorite parts shop. They suggested self energizing alt, I bought it took it home and found it would not fit my mounts. So I took it back. They tried find a standard alt. could not find one in our small town, ended up buying a model for a different engine and changed pulleys and re-clocked the case to fit my brackets. Back working again. Starting to drive it around as my daily driver for a while and see what other gremlins pop up. I am liking the way it drive smooth ride good handling. The brakes are working great. Looks like it is going to be fun to drive.
